First, latest Asphyre version is barely a week old. Second, Asphyre has limited 3D support meaning that it can display only static 3D meshes (no animations). Since Asphyre does not require any DLLs (D3DX and so on), we had to write our own 3DS and ASE loader. The time is short so we never figured out how to load animations (and Soulhab left our team, so it takes more time for me to maintain Asphyre). Other than that, it supports 3D cameras, billboards, "facing" primitives (like billboards, but can have any orientation) and some more stuff. It's not a 3D engine though.Originally Posted by Firlefanz
